site stats

Can bit timing logic

WebIn a CAN protocol controller, the Bit Timing Logic (BTL) state machine is evaluated once each time quantum and synchroniz-es the position of the Sample-Point to a specific … WebApr 28, 2024 · CAN-FD may be seen by a normal CAN receiver as having bit stuffing errors, because the timing of the data is different. If any nodes are transmitting at the wrong baud rate, that will be seen as frame errors, which may be bit stuffing errors.

Configure CAN Bit Timing to Optimize Performance

WebRevision 3.3.0 M_CAN 3.1.0 22.07.2014 Register FBTP renamed to DBTP and restructured •TDCO moved to new register TDCR • increased configuration range for data bit timing Register TEST restructured •TDCV moved to register PSR Register CCCR restructured • FDBS and FDO removed • new control bitEFBI replaces status flagFDBS WebMar 12, 2024 · Hi, I have problems with setting proper CAN baud rate for CAN network with baud rate approx. 65.83Kbit/s. Please clarify the following points: 1. For default settings of S32K144 Devkit (XTAL freq. 8MHz, System Clock freq. 80MHz): - setting "CAN Engine Clock Source" as 'Peripheral clock' -> gives CA... how do math teachers use geometry https://dimagomm.com

MCP2515 Stand-Alone CAN Controller with SPI Interface Data …

WebTiming parameters A CAN bus system uses a nominal bit rate fnbr (in bits per second) which is uniform throughout the network. Each node in a CAN network has to perform frequent „hard synchronization“ and „re-Page 1 of 7 UAB Elektromotus Žirmūnų g. 68, Vilnius www.elektromotus.lt Tel: +370 68611131 Įm. k: 302505285 PVM k: … WebThe results show that the design work which obeys the CAN2.0 protocol, can more easily deal with the CAN bus communication bit timing, realized the control of CAN bus … http://www.bittiming.can-wiki.info/ how much power does nuclear fusion produce

MCP2515 Family Data Sheet - Microchip Technology

Category:CAN Bit Timing and Calculation - embedclogic.com

Tags:Can bit timing logic

Can bit timing logic

MCP2515 Family Data Sheet - Microchip Technology

WebJun 13, 2004 · The paper describes the implementation of the bit timing logic of a CAN controller on an Altera® Stratix™ FPGA board. The bit timing logic corresponds to the physical signaling sub-layer and is ... WebNov 28, 2024 · This is accomplished by continuously adjusting the bit sample point during each bit time. The purpose of bit timing synchronization is to coordinate the oscillator …

Can bit timing logic

Did you know?

Webpaper examines the relationship and constraints between the bit timing parameters, the reference oscillator tolerance, and the various signal propagation delays in the system. 2 CAN Bit Timing Overview 2.1 CAN Bit Structure The Nominal Bit Rate of the network is uniform throughout the network and is given by: (1) where tNBT is the Nominal Bit ... Web6 hours ago · It's timing, however, that animates Spectre. ... the 6.2 kernel had logic that opted out of STIBP (Single Thread Indirect Branch Predictors), a defense against the sharing of branch prediction between logical processors on a core. "The IBRS bit implicitly protects against cross-thread branch target injection," the bug report explains. ...

First check the possible configurations given the desired data rate and the CAN-controller clock. The TQ interval must be calculated based on the clock and various BRP values, and only the combinations where the TQ interval divides into the bit time by an integer number are possible. Depending on the … See more Controller area network (CAN) offers robust communication between multiple network locations, supporting a variety of data rates and distances. Featuring data-link layer arbitration, synchronization, and error handling, CAN … See more For harsh industrial and automotive environments, system robustness can be further enhanced by isolating the logic interface to the CAN transceiver, allowing large potential … See more With isolation, an extra element must be considered in the round trip propagation delay calculation. Digital isolators reduce the propagation delay compared to optocouplers, but even the fastest isolated CAN transceivers will … See more Implementing a CAN node requires an isolated or nonisolated CAN transceiver and a CAN controller or processor with the appropriate protocol stack. Standalone CAN controllers can be used, even without a standard protocol … See more

WebDec 15, 1997 · 24 MHz Clock frequency Faster microprocessor access and more CAN bit-timing options. Receive Comparator Bypass Shortens the internal delays, resulting in a … WebIt also performs the error detection, arbitration, stuffing and error handling on the CAN-bus. 6.1.6 BITTIMINGLOGIC(BTL) The bit timing logic monitors the serial CAN-bus line and …

WebTo initialize the CAN Controller, the CPU has to set up the Bit Timing Register and each Message Object. If a Message Object is not needed, it is sufficient to set it’sMsgVal bit …

Web3 Bit timing configuration. Configuring the bit timing registers, it is possible to define the position of the sample point for all the bits that the controller gets on the bus and the baud-rate as well. For each bit, three sections are available, as shown in the following figure. Figure 2. Bit timing how do math functions workWebThe bit timing for each node in a CAN system is derived from the reference frequency (fOSC) of its node. This creates a situation where phase shifting and oscillator drift will … how do math tutors help kids with augismWebThe data link layer of CAN and physical bit timing is implemented by the CAN controller (sometimes embedded within a micro-controller or digital signal processor (DSP), for … how do math workWebDec 28, 2024 · In this column, we take a closer look as to how timing and delays affect our logic circuits. As part of this, we start to consider the timing diagrams presented in data sheets. As I was writing my previous column, I realized that I had neglected to cover the timing aspects of logic design. Other than mentioning propagation delay and expressing ... how much power does shaggy haveWebThe primary functions of the Bit Timing Logic (BTL) module include: † Synchronizing the CAN controller to CAN traffic on the bus † Sampling the bus and extracting the data … how do mathematicians do researchWebMay 31, 2024 · The Timer Timing bit is True when the timer is actively performing the timing operation. The Done bit goes TRUE when the timer has counted up to reach its Preset. ... In this line of logic, you can see I have set up a Reset to be triggered when a user hits a button to tell the PLC that the service is complete for our RTO example … how much power does sleep mode saveWebFrom the logic for the X register we can see that each additional subtraction, in effect, adds one 4-bit subtractor unit and one 4-bit 2-to-1 multiplexer to the longest path in the data path unit. Figure 7: Implementation of one subtractor The above logic can also be implemented in VHDL code by using a for-loop that implicitly performs the how much power does russia have